3 weeks?! Lawd jeezus. Here is my process that seems to work pretty well. Put the seeds in a paper towel and wet it. Put this on a plate and let the excess water run off. Now put another plate over top the other one to essentially make a plate humidity dome. Put them on a warm heating surface like a floor register for your furnace (off center) in the winter, a heating pad, or even something like a cable box as long as it isn't getting too hot. You should have roots in 24 hours and ready to plant in 48-72 hours. Much longer than that and it's a safe bet your seeds won't ever germinate. When popping seeds like this I take the straggler seeds that haven't germinated and gently crack them between my teeth. Sometimes this works and other times the seed is essentially just never gonna happen and you can chuck them out.
